Ukraine and Norway are set to begin their first joint production of Ukrainian drones, planning to produce several thousand mid-range drones for the Ukrainian Armed Forces in Norway.
"All products manufactured under the project will be transferred to the Ukrainian Armed Forces… The relevant agreement was signed in Kyiv by Lars Ragnar Aalerud Hansen, Norwegian Ambassador to Ukraine, and Serhii Boiev, Ukraine's Deputy Minister of Defence for European Integration," Ukraine's Ministry of Defence reports.
The defence ministry said the agreement will enable Ukrainian technology, which has proved its effectiveness on the battlefield, to be scaled up and will strengthen the defence capabilities of both countries.
The project will be funded by Norway.
